안녕하세요, 베릴로그응애입니다. 오늘은 베릴로그의 또 다른 데이터형 중 하나인 reg형 데이터에 대해 다루어 보겠습니다.
그리고 reg형 데이터에 값을 할당할 수 있는 절차적 할당문(procedual assignment)에 대해서도 말씀드리겠습니다. net형 데이터와 비교하시기 쉽도록, 글의 구성이나 예제는 저번 게시물인 "6. net형 데이터와 연속 할당문(assign문)"과 최대한 비슷하게 구성했습니다. 두 게시글을 반복해서 읽으시면 공부가 더 잘 되실 거에요. reg형 데이터 저번 시간에 배운 net형 데이터가 소자 간의 연결을 표현하는 데이터형이었다면, reg형 데이터는 특정 값을 저장할 수 있는 데이터형이라고 할 수 있습니다.
실제로 reg형으로 선언된 변수는 다음 상태까지 그 값을 유지하게 됩니다. reg형 데이터는 데이터를 저장하는 역할을 하기에, 마치 레지스터와도 같은 역할을 한다고 하여 "reg" 키워드로 선언합니다. 예시는 아래와 같습니다. * 베릴로그에서 reg형...
#
reg
#
Verilog
#
레지스터
#
베릴로그
#
비메모리반도체
#
절차적할당문